ROAD LIGHTING IN BROAD BAY

Sir—We have been advised that a petition In favour of road lighting is being circulated in a portion of the township. It would be interesting to ascertain what section of the ratepayers is going to benefit from the scheme, and where the lights will be placed over an area more than a mile long. -According to a p an before the County Council, nearly all the lights are to be on the main highway. Lights on the highway are of no benent to the ratepayers, and would be a definite nuisance to bus drivers and motorists. The idea fostered by half-crown ratepayers and guests of the State is as worthy of support as their proposal to make the Peninsula County into a borough. No doubt these people have the same power as those who pay the taxes and have none of the responsibilities, but before handing over control of their taxes, ratepayers would do well to ascertain some further details of the scheme, management and costs.—l am, e t c Occasional Resident..
